In Russia, the demand for titanium for knee replacement is driven by an aging population and a significant increase in sports-related trauma. The region's harsh winter climates often exacerbate joint degeneration, leading to a higher incidence of severe osteoarthritis among the adult population.
Economic shifts toward localized high-tech medical manufacturing have pushed Russian clinics to seek materials that offer superior osseointegration. Titanium alloys are preferred over cobalt-chrome in many Russian centers due to their lower modulus of elasticity, which reduces stress shielding in the femur and tibia.
Furthermore, the integration of total knee replacement titanium components is becoming a standard in state-funded medical programs, focusing on long-term implant survival rates to reduce the burden of revision surgeries in remote regional hospitals.
